#d0f4fd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d0f4fd is composed of 81.6% red, 95.7% green and 99.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.8% cyan, 3.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 192 degrees, a saturation of 91.8% and a lightness of 90.4%. #d0f4fd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a1e9fb. Closest websafe color is: #ccffff.

#d0f4fd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d0f4fd has RGB values of R:208, G:244, B:253 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0.04, Y:0, K:0.01. Its decimal value is 13694205.

Shades and Tints of #d0f4fd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000809 is the darkest color, while #f6fd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d0f4fd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e5e8e8 is the less saturated color, while #cef5ff is the most saturated one.
